NHC AL122005 · Atlantic basin

Hurricane Katrina (2005)

August 23, 2005 – August 31, 2005

Hurricane Katrina peaked at Category 5 with 173 mph sustained winds and passed within 75 miles of 384 US cities, 210 of them while still at hurricane strength.

About this record

The track is the National Hurricane Center's best-track record, revised after the season with every observation available. Strength at a city is the sustained wind on the track at the closest point, not the wind that city measured.
